#9b8982 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b8982 is composed of 60.8% red, 53.7%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 16.1%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 16.8 degrees, a saturation of 11.1% and a lightness of 55.9%. #9b8982 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#371305.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#9b8982 color description : Dark grayish orange.
#9b8982 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b8982 has RGB values of R:155, G:137,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.16,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10193282.
